The advice for a strong opening guess still holds: choose a word with at least two different vowels and common consonants such as S, T, R or N. That archive change matters because Wordle is no longer just a daily puzzle; it is part of a larger subscription product, and fans who want to revisit older boards now have to do it through the Times. Mashable also noted that alternate versions such as Squabble, Heardle, Dordle and Quordle were built by fans, a sign of how far the original game’s reach has spread.
